The Easiest Lemon Cheesecake: A Delightfully Creamy Treat
The Easiest Lemon Cheesecake is a delightful dessert that is creamy and refreshing, perfect for any occasion.

- 1 1/2 cups graham cracker crumbs
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ted
- 2 packages (8 ounces each) cream cheese, softened
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 3 large eggs
- 1/4 cup fresh lemon juice
- 1 tablespoon lemon zest
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- Preheat the oven to 325°F (160°C).
- In a bowl, combine the graham cracker crumbs and melted butter. Press the mixture into the bottom of a 9-inch springform pan.
- In a large mixing bowl, beat the cream cheese until smooth. Gradually add in the sugar, mixing until well combined.
- Add the eggs one at a time, mixing thoroughly after each addition.
- Stir in the lemon juice, lemon zest, and vanilla extract until just combined.
- Pour the cheesecake batter over the crust in the springform pan.
- Bake for 50-60 minutes or until the center is set and slightly jiggly.
- Remove from the oven and let cool. Refrigerate for at least 4 hours before serving.
Notes
- For a stronger lemon flavor, add more lemon zest.
- Serve with fresh berries or a fruit compote on top.
